# Larkspur Launch Plan (Managers Only)

Welcome aboard! Here's the short version: Larkspur ships in early spring, pending the final round of durability testing at the Ostbridge lab. Pricing lands between our Fenwick line and the premium tier. Retail partners are briefed, press embargo holds until launch week. The bigger strategic picture is captured in the note below.

management briefing: Project Ulavan slips by two quarters because of the staffing delay.

Sweeper overview: the Dustbin service runs nightly at 02:00, deleting records past policy age across the Larkfield clusters. Dry-run mode is default on new tables — flip the config flag only after legal sign-off. Metrics land in the retention dashboard; alert fires if a sweep skips two nights. Do not pause sweeps without a ticket. New joiners: read the policy matrix first, then shadow one sweep cycle. Questions during onboarding go to the retention owner.

alerts address for bajop-yahog: istwyn@lumiclabs.internal

## Deployment

The reminder job for Maplebrook Clinic runs nightly on the Larkspur scheduler. Nothing fancy — it pulls tomorrow's appointments and queues texts before 7pm local time. If it dies, just redeploy; it's idempotent, so nobody gets double-pinged. Before shipping, make sure the runtime picks up the following settings.

settings of kawig-kahip:
ULAETH_PIN=4988
ULAETH_TENANT=briath
ULAETH_METRICS_HOST=metrics.ulaeth.xolmarworks.test
ULAETH_SEAL=seal_e1a2fe42
ULAETH_STANDBY_TEAM=pelix